The video tutorial explains the concept of moments, which are the turning effects of forces on objects. It covers the two rotational directions: clockwise and anticlockwise. The tutorial discusses factors affecting the size of a moment, such as the magnitude of the force and the distance from the pivot point. It introduces the formula for calculating moments (M = F * d) and provides examples to illustrate the calculation process. The video also demonstrates how to determine force or distance when given the moment.
